Agave-Mustard Hummus Salad Dressing

by John Tanner last modified Oct. 21, 2014

A tangy no-oil salad dressing

Adapted from "Simple No Tahini Hummus" on page 158 and "Hummus Salad Dressing" on page 167 of "Prevent and Reverse Heart Disease" by Caldwell B. Esselstyn, Jr., M.D.

This stores well, but doesn't last long because it tastes so good. After a couple weeks, it may separate a little, but stirring will mix it right back again to a uniform consistency.

Makes about 3 cups

1 15oz can chickpeas
2 cloves crushed garlic
3 tbsp lemon juice
4 tbsp water
1 tsp Bragg Liquid Aminos or 1/8 tsp salt
1/2 cup agave syrup
1/2 cup yellow mustard or 1/4 cup Dijon mustard

Mix all ingredients well in a blender.
